Step 4: Enable trace propagation before deploying the Threadline collector. Every service in the Orbment mesh must forward the trace-context header; verify this with the smoke suite in tools/tracecheck, which exercises the checkout, inventory, and ledger services end to end. Once all spans appear in the Lanternview UI with no orphaned roots, build the collector image and sign it—unsigned images are rejected by the admission controller. Sign with the deploy key provided below.

signing key of hahag-tahag = bky4_v18e

## Action item: consent banner retry limits

During the Quartzleaf consent banner rollout, slow consent-service responses caused the banner to re-prompt users repeatedly, driving a spike in support tickets. We are adding client-side caching of consent state and hard limits on re-prompt frequency. Support should reference this page when users report duplicate banners. The agreed limits are as follows.

tuning constants:
QUOTAS = {
    "druwyn": 5,
    "holix": 5,
    "zorath": 5,
    "holwyn": 10,
}

## Break-Glass: Conversion Rounding Audit

If the Marivel ledger shows rounding drift above 0.5 basis points in currency conversion, break-glass access to the rate-adjustment console is authorized. Document the drift amount, affected pairs, and reviewer approval before proceeding. To unseal the console, the steward must supply the recovery passphrase recorded below.

vault phrase of kahip-bajog = praath-gordor-juleth-istys-quenion

Ticket — missed pick-up. Score sheets from the Ashgrove Regional Chess Final were not collected Monday; Larkmoor Couriers logged the stop as "closed." Sealed envelope remains in the warehouse office safe drawer. Federation office at Threlby needs originals by Friday. Shift lead: rebook collection for Wednesday AM, release only against the driver's run sheet. Note it on the outbound board. At the hand-over itself, apply the confidential instruction below.

handover note for hafop-bagug: the holok frair courier leaves the rusvan novmir eliix gilath oliiel kasix eliax wenmir ledger at gate 3383 under passcode 753647